“Rich states will save their companies with large sums of money, while the poor cannot. It is the beginning of cannibalism in the EU»: It is the grim prophecy of Viktor Orbán. In a video posted on Twitter by his advisor Balazs Orbán, the Hungarian premier has in fact commented on the 200 billion shield against the price of gas announced by Germany. German Prime Minister Olaf Scholz had commented on the maneuver calling it “a clear response to Putin, but also a clear signal to the country”. And specifying: “We are economically strong. And we mobilize this economic force when it is needed, like now ». According to Orbán, this decision is potentially “explosive”: “There is no common European solution to help European societies, sanctions have been imposed on everyone, but there is no common financial fund to offset the effects“. Therefore, concludes the leader of Budapest, we must urge Brussels to intervene: “European unity” is at stake.
